Bob DavyBOB DAVY is a commercial pilot and aviation journalist. He has 16,000 flying hours in 300 different fixed-wing aircraft … but not helicopters. Bob says he is allergic to them! He is lucky because he regularly flies three of his favourite aircraft: th North American P-51 Mustang, the Nanchang CJ-6A, and his own Yak-3 UTI. Bob produced his first aviation journalistic contribution when he completed a flight test article on the Aeronca Chief back in 1990, and his journalistic work has subsequently been published all over the world. In addition to writing hundreds of flight tests, he has written and published two novels: In Case of War Break Glass, Parts 1 and 2. These follow the life of a fighter pilot in the Second World War, Korea, and Vietnam and are loosely based on the life of Robin Olds. Read More Read Less
